Solution for 3.14 is what percent of 63:

3.14:63*100 =

(3.14*100):63 =

314:63 = 4.984126984127

Now we have: 3.14 is what percent of 63 = 4.984126984127

Question: 3.14 is what percent of 63?

Percentage solution with steps:

Step 1: We make the assumption that 63 is 100% since it is our output value.

Step 2: We next represent the value we seek with {x}.

Step 3: From step 1, it follows that {100\%}={63}.

Step 4: In the same vein, {x\%}={3.14}.

Step 5: This gives us a pair of simple equations:

{100\%}={63}(1).

{x\%}={3.14}(2).

Step 6: By simply dividing equation 1 by equation 2 and taking note of the fact that both the LHS
(left hand side) of both equations have the same unit (%); we have

\frac{100\%}{x\%}=\frac{63}{3.14}

Step 7: Taking the inverse (or reciprocal) of both sides yields

\frac{x\%}{100\%}=\frac{3.14}{63}

\Rightarrow{x} = {4.984126984127\%}

Therefore, {3.14} is {4.984126984127\%} of {63}.
